Israeli Settlers Trap Palestinian Families in West Bank Homes as Military Sends  Israel’s military deployed additional troops to the occupied West Bank village of Qusra on Thursday after Israeli settlers surrounded three Palestinian homes, cutting off access and leaving families unable to enter or leave.

The confrontation began over the weekend when settlers blocked the road leading to the homes and erected a tent in their front yards, according to Palestinian residents. The families said the settlers had earlier cut off their water and electricity supplies.

The Palestinians have described the action as an attempt to force them from their land.

The Israeli military said it was seeking to disperse the settlers and restore security in the area. A previous attempt by troops to remove them using tear gas was unsuccessful.

The military subsequently announced that additional forces had been sent to Qusra to conduct what it described as “defensive missions and patrols” aimed at maintaining security and protecting the area.

Questions have also emerged over the conduct of some Israeli military personnel after video footage from earlier in the week appeared to show men in military uniform joining the settlers for morning prayers in the tent erected outside the Palestinian homes.

The Israeli military said it was investigating the incident and would take disciplinary action against any personnel involved.

The standoff comes amid continuing tensions in the occupied West Bank, where disputes over settlements and Palestinian land have increasingly been accompanied by confrontations involving settlers, local residents and Israeli forces.
